How do I legally hire a virtual assistant?

Here are 6 steps you can follow to hire a Virtual Assistant:

  1. Step 1: Document the tasks you want to outsource.
  2. Step 2: Create a job description.
  3. Step 3: Post your job description online.
  4. Step 4: Review applications & schedule interviews.
  5. Step 5: Give your top candidates a test.
  6. Step 6: Give the best candidate a trial period.

How do I find a virtual personal assistant?

The best way to find a virtual assistant is to ask your network for referrals. Just as with any position, people who come with a recommendation are much more likely to have what you’re looking for. Start by posting on LinkedIn, as well as any Slack or Facebook groups for business owners.

What does a legal virtual assistant do?

A virtual legal assistant is a professional who works remotely for your law firm from anywhere in the country without the need for infrastructure, tools, or other benefits from you. They work on an hourly basis, so it also saves you a few bucks.

What do you call someone who is a virtual assistant?

A virtual assistant (VA), also known as a virtual personal assistant, or personal office assistant, is someone who assists businesses virtually from a remote location such as a home. VAs are mainly in demand by entrepreneurs and online small businesses in need of help .
